Transaction 69ee6b56db32f1c1cda899afe7d2b1e68fd49a6236fac64b1afaace719cca414

block
8cca2a4bc73b0ba47acb1c3cda68335c043c18b4ebca2143caf3e9c9d8231c5d

1 Input

23 Outputs